Guests dance at the wedding party of Tricia Nixon in Washington DC. A hall in the White House. The guests in the party. Two flower girls with bouquets in their hands. The elder girl talks to the guests. Some of the guests start dancing. The newly married couple dances in the center.
The cake cutting ceremony at the wedding party of Tricia Nixon in Washington DC. A decorated hall in the White House. Guests at the party. A big wedding cake in the center. Tricia Nixon and Edward Finch Cox proceed towards the cake. A man gives a knife to the couple. The couple cuts the multi tiered cake. They talk to each other.
Tricia Nixon throws a bouquet during her wedding party in Washington DC. A decorated hall in the White House. Guests in the party. Tricia Nixon Cox and Edward Finch Cox standing on a staircase. Tricia throws her bouquet towards the guests. The couple climbs down the stairs to join the guests.
Guests dance at Tricia Nixon's wedding in Washington DC. A decorated hall in the White House. U.S. President Richard Nixon dances with his wife Patricia Ryan Nixon. Guests in the party clap. Some other couples also dance. A flower girl dances with the groom Edward Cox. Tricia Nixon dances with a guest. President Nixon dances with a woman. Patricia meet some guests. The veil of Tricia's wedding dress. Tricia with his father. President Nixon dances with the flower girl.
Tricia Nixon's wedding cake in Washington DC. A large white creamy cake. The cake is decorated with white creamy decorative bird couples. The cake is multi tiered and is decorated with white flowers twigs.
Tricia Nixon's first dance during her wedding celebration in Washington DC. Tricia Nixon smiles. Guests clap for her. She approaches her husband Edward Cox. The couple performs their first dance. The guests watch them dancing. Both U.S. President Richard Nixon and his wife Patricia Nixon clap. President Nixon dances with his daughter. Edward dances with Patricia. Tricia holds a white flower bouquet in her hand. An official in a white uniform in the background. The guests congratulate the couple. President Nixon greets his guests.
